Flow Control Interface - 7.2 English

AXI 1G/2.5G Ethernet Subsystem Product Guide (PG138)

Document ID
PG138
Release Date
2023-11-15
Version
7.2 English

The flow control ports are described in the following table. These signals are used to request a flow-control action from the transmit engine. Valid flow control frames received by the MAC are automatically handled. The pause value in the received frame is used to inhibit the transmitter operation for the time defined in IEEE 802.3-2008 specification. The frame is then passed to the client with rx_axis_mac_tuser asserted to indicate to the client that it should be dropped.

Table 1. Flow Control Interface Ports
Signal Name Direction Description
s_axis_pause_tvalid In It provides the pause request to the TEMAC. Upon request the MAC transmits a pause frame upon completion of the current data packet.
s_axis_pause_tdata[15:0] In This is the pause value to the TEMAC. This value inserted into the parameter field of the transmitted pause frame.